Description

A kind of storing parts device for ejecting
Technical field
This utility model is used for article-storage device automatic spring technical field, particularly relates to a kind of storing parts device for ejecting.
Background technology
Basket, refuse receptacle are drawn in drawer, storage tank, kitchen, as being used for depositing the facility of article or rubbish in people's daily life, for the essential items of daily living article.In kitchen, hospital, hotel all has configuration.For the attractive in appearance and overall perception of finishing, it will usually the version installed in using cabinet.But, the drawer that is installed in cupboard, storage tank, kitchen draw basket, refuse receptacle to pull out by hand could throw in article or rubbish, pull out by hand the structure of formula, for refuse receptacle, there is the risk becoming easily infected by foul antibacterial, draw basket then can affect the ease of use of this device for drawer, storage tank, kitchen.Unresolved the problems referred to above, occur in that the automatically pulling structure using built-in rebounding device on the market, but the slide rail of existing built-in rebounding device, then can only eject the length of 3cm, cannot be by whole for refuse receptacle ejection, and it is non-adjustable that the slide rail of built-in rebounding device ejects dynamics, therefore basket, refuse receptacle is drawn to have no practical value for answering for drawer, storage tank, kitchen.

Detailed description of the invention
Referring to figs. 1 through Fig. 8, that show the concrete structure of the preferred embodiment of this utility model.Will be detailed below the construction features of each element of this utility model, if and when being described direction (upper and lower, left and right, before and after), it is to describe for reference with the structure shown in Fig. 1, Fig. 2, but actually used direction of the present utility model is not limited thereto.
This utility model provides a kind of storing parts device for ejecting, including bottom slide track, bottom slide 2, ejecting mechanism 3 and locking relieving mechanism 4, there is on described bottom slide 2 the placement position that can place storing parts 1, described storing parts 1 include drawer, storage tank, basket is drawn in kitchen, refuse receptacle, placing position is the concave surface being located at slide 2 top, bottom, described bottom slide 2 is contained in described bottom slide track and can reciprocatingly slide along described bottom slide track, described locking relieving mechanism 4 can lock when bottom slide 2 slides into bottom slide track end or discharge described bottom slide 2, described ejecting mechanism 3 provides the driving force that can be ejected by described bottom slide 2 to bottom slide track front end.This utility model is in use, generally under state, storing parts 1 are placed on the slide 2 of bottom, the end of bottom slide track it is accommodated in bottom slide 2, and locked by locking relieving mechanism 4, when needing to pick and place article, rubbish in storing parts 1, slide 2 bottom locking relieving mechanism 4 release, storing parts 1 just can skid off along bottom slide track 2 under the effect of ejecting mechanism 3 with bottom slide 2.This utility model uses the version that can eject, and may be mounted in cupboard, it is not necessary to pull out by hand during use, only need to push away bullet with foot, can eject by Long travel, this device can make user liberate both hands, easy-to-use, and reducing antibacterial infection, saving takes up room, convenient for collecting.
Wherein, described bottom slide track includes left slideway 51 and right slideway 52, and the left and right sides of described bottom slide 2 forms the side frame assembled respectively with left slideway 51 and right slideway 52, the front side of bottom slide 2 be provided with between two side frames before frame, front frame is provided with promotion cue mark.It is provided with U-shaped link between described left slideway 51 and right slideway 52, U-shaped link includes the front U-shaped link 53 being positioned at left slideway 51 and right slideway 52 front bottom end and is positioned at the rear U-shaped link 54 bottom left slideway 51 and right slideway 52 rear end, described ejecting mechanism 3 includes the accumulator 31 being located on described front U-shaped link 53 and the tooth bar 32 being located on described bottom slide 2, accumulator 31 is contained on front U-shaped link 53 by accumulator seat, and described accumulator 31 has and the gear of described tooth bar 32 engaged transmission.Described accumulator 31 includes shell, the gear shaft being located in described shell and is contained in described shell and gear between centers and the adjustable scroll spring of the number of turns, one end of scroll spring is connected with shell, the other end is connected with gear shaft, and described gear is fixedly mounted on described gear shaft.By regulating the number of turns of scroll spring, the regulation of ejection dynamics can be realized.Thus realize ejecting the change of stroke.During promoting described bottom slide 2 to slide backward along bottom slide track, accumulator 31 realizes the energy storage of scroll spring by gear and tooth bar 32 engaged transmission, when bottom slide 2 is ejected by the tip forward of bottom slide track, the scroll spring release elastic force of accumulator 31, and realize elastic force output on bottom slide 2 by gear, tooth bar 32 engaged transmission.
nullDescribed locking relieving mechanism 4 includes being located at the chute box 41 bottom described bottom slide 2 and the block 42 set on U-shaped link 54 in the rear,It is provided with slide block guide groove 43 in described chute box 41、Slide bar guide groove 44、The slide block that can slide along described slide block guide groove 43 and the slide bar 45 that can slide along described slide bar guide groove 44,Described slide bar guide groove 44 is positioned at the front of described slide block guide groove 43,The far-end of described slide bar guide groove 44 is provided with draw-in groove 46,Described slide block and slide bar 45 are connected by connecting rod 48,There is on slide block cocker residence and state the screens 410 of block 42,It is provided with in chute box 41 and slide block can be made to have the back-moving spring 49 sliding to slide block guide groove 43 near-end trend,The driving force overcoming described accumulator 31 promote described bottom slide 2 along bottom slide track slide backward time,In block 42 embeds described screens 410 and prop up described slide block,Slide block slides along described slide block guide groove 43,Slide block promotes described slide bar 45 to slide to slide bar guide groove 44 far-end by connecting rod 48,When bottom slide 2 slides into the rear end of bottom slide track,Described slide bar 45 embeds in described draw-in groove 46,Slide 2 bottom locking relieving mechanism 4 locking;Again promoting described bottom slide 2, slide block promotes described slide bar 45 to deviate from draw-in groove 46 by connecting rod 48, and slide 2 bottom locking relieving mechanism 4 release, described bottom slide 2 skids off forward along bottom slide track under the effect of accumulator 31 driving force.
As preferably, described slide bar guide groove 44 is in the form of a ring, the far-end of slide bar guide groove 44 has turning, and the draw-in groove 46 embedded for slide bar 45 is formed by described turning, slide bar guide groove 44 be divided in the both sides at turning bootable slide bar 45 slip in draw-in groove 46 enter that guide groove and bootable slide bar 45 exit draw-in groove 46 exit guide groove, slide bar 45 is entering and is exiting respectively through different paths, makes the slide bar 45 embedding in draw-in groove 46 and to exit process more smooth.
In order to increase the smoothness that slide bar 45 coordinates with slide bar guide groove 44, described slide bar 45 is provided with the bearing that can roll along slide bar guide groove 44.
Described slide block includes leading portion 411 and back segment 412, described leading portion 411 and back segment 412 pass through hinge, described back segment 412 has two latches 47, described screens 410 is formed between two latches 47, the near-end of described slide block guide groove 43 has the bending segment slipped into for described back segment 412, when described back segment 412 slips into described bending segment, latch 47 away from described leading portion 411 is retracted in chute box 41, latch 47 near described leading portion 411 then stretches out outside chute box 41, so that chute box 41 is when rearward movement, block 42 can snap in the screens 410 between two latches 47 smoothly, on described leading portion 411, the inwall with chute box 41 is provided with the spring base connecting described back-moving spring 49.
Additionally, this utility model also includes the top cover 6 being located at above described bottom slide track.Described rear U-shaped link 54 is provided with n shape frame 61, some connection sheets 62 being rotationally connected with described n shape frame 61 top it are provided with bottom the rear end of described top cover 6, the front end side wall of described top cover 6 is connected by strut 63 with described bottom slide 2, the two ends of described strut 63 are hinged with top cover 6 and bottom slide 2 respectively, and strut 63 is positioned at rearward position in the middle part of the slide 2 of bottom with the pin joint of bottom slide 2.Bottom slide 2 is along during bottom slide track slide anteroposterior, strut 63 can experience the angular transformation process of inclination → vertically → inclination, the elevation that this utility model is brought by the angular transformation of strut 63 changes, realize the top cover 6 small angle oscillation around n shape frame 61, it is respectively provided with cocker residence on described connection sheet 62 and states the arc bayonet socket of n shape frame 61, the medium position of described n shape frame 61 is provided with and is available for described in one connecting the cannelure 64 that sheet 62 embeds, cannelure 64 coordinates with being connected sheet 62, limits the top cover 6 transverse shifting on n shape frame 61.
